Location:
Thuringia | Rural district Altenburger Land | 04626 Thonhausen, Dorfstraße 65-69
Completion/Inauguration:
April 2017
Previously: Disused transformer station © SPA
Now: Sanctuary for structure-dwelling wildlife
© Pröhl/fokus-natur
Stiftung Pro Artenvielfalt, Bielefeld – Species conservation building
Conversion of the species conservation building € 16,000.00
Stiftung Pro Artenvielfalt, Bielefeld
52 fitted nest boxes, hiding places (roosts) and bat quarters
Common Kestrel, Barn Owl, Eurasian Jackdaw, Common Swift, House Martin, Starling, Black Redstart, Pied Wagtail, House and Tree Sparrow, several bat species such as Common Pipistrelle and Daubenton’s Bat
